The influence of processing material and cutting thickness on laser power
The power selection of the metal pipe cutting machine has a great relationship with the actual processing material and the actual cutting thickness. The laser has different effects on different metal materials, and the laser power varies with the metal material.
For example, under the same thickness, the laser power for cutting carbon steel is lower than that of stainless steel, and the laser power for cutting stainless steel is lower than that of brass. In addition to the characteristics of the metal itself, the laser power is also closely related to the thickness of the material. For the same sheet metal, the cutting power of 10mm is lower than 20mm. The cutting thickness also affects the smoothness of the cut surface of the sheet metal.

Laser power selection
There are many mainstream metal cutting machines on the market, ranging from 1000W to 20000W. Most metal manufacturers' sheet thicknesses are between 8mm-12mm. If cutting this thickness for a long time, it is recommended to choose 4000W-6000W laser cutting machine. If it is high-reflective brass, it is recommended to use a laser cutting machine with a power above 6000W. It is recommended to use a 2000W-4000W laser cutting machine for metal sheets with a thickness of 5mm-8mm. A 1000W laser generator is usually sufficient for cutting sheets of lower thickness.
